| Load iPod Classic firmware to 5.5Gen iPod video?
Is it possible with an app like Alterpod? Is there a place to get the firmware from the new 80GB iPod Classic? Thanks

I don't think so. My guess would be that a little bit about the hardware has been changed as well, not only the firmware. Plus: Why would you want to? It offers more bloat, makes the iPod feel slow when compared to the 5G and 5.5G iPods and doesn't really offer more feature-wise. CoverFlow, basically, and that's said to be jaggy and slow on the 6G iPods.
